SIBI-P1 H2319-02
new (feminine singular)
| Root | חדש (ch-d-sh) |
| Core Meanings | newness, freshness, renewal, restoration |
| Semantic Range | new, fresh, recent, renewed, unused, unprecedented |
| Conceptual Significance | This term marks what is freshly brought forth—whether a new king, a new song, or a new covenant—often signaling renewal after decline or divine initiative in history. |
| Morphological Notes | Adjective, feminine singular absolute (from חָדָשׁ). Used to modify feminine singular nouns such as עִיר (city) or בְּרִית (covenant). |
| Rendering Rationale | The adjective derives from the root חדש, expressing newness or freshness. The form חֲדָשָׁה is feminine singular absolute, so the rendering preserves its singular sense and notes its feminine agreement, reflecting that it modifies a feminine noun. |
